Overview
Welcome to Amoresville, a small mountain town founded on love and filled with colorful characters.All June needs in life is an open road, good tunes, and her trusty VW Van, Daisy. As a travel writer, she explores tucked away towns across the country. Her devoted social media followers love to tag along virtually as she uncovers hidden gems. Those faceless people on the other side of the screen are as close to a family as she has. When June hears about a wacky town in the northern mountains of Pennsylvania with an equally wacky name, she knows readers will eat up the local flavor and points Daisy in that direction.As the eldest brother of the Halstead siblings, Knox doesnt have time for a social life. And he doesnt want one either. His family tree stretches all the way back to the founding of Amoresville. Hell, the town square was even built smack dab on the spot where his great-grand parents several generations removed consummated their love. Now, the fate of the family farm rests directly on his shoulders, nearly crushing him.Can a dangerously curvy road, one giant pumpkin, and the towns meddling cafe owner (AKA Knoxs mom) intervene to bring these two hyper-independent, stubborn people together?
